Mac Miller's loved ones remember him on the third anniversary of his death.
In 2018 Mac whose real name is Malcolm James McCormick, was found dead in his Los Angeles home from an accidental drug overdose due to a “mixed drug toxicity” of cocaine, fentanyl, and alcohol.
And Annually, the rapper's family friends, and fans gather at the famous Blue Slide Park to celebrate the late rapper’s legacy, However, the event was canceled last year due to the unfortunate events of COVID-19.
